Bug description:
  i am using ubuntu 12.04LTS(precise pangolin) in my desktop of hardware:
  RAM:1.8 GB
  processor:Pentium(R) Dual-core CPU E5500@ 2.80GHz
  when opening update manager an error messsage is popping titled 'cannot initialize package information' and an error message  showing beneath it as below:
  'E:Opening /etc/apt/sources.list.d/private-ppa.launchpad.net_commercial-ppa-uploaders_fullcircle-issue-60_ubuntu.list - ifstream::ifstream (13: Permission denied)'
  my ubuntu software center also got the problem it open ups and closes quickly as it opens,
  as in the error message i also got two issues of full circle magazine issue 59&60,as i seen the error message i removed both using synaptic package manager but still the problem persists
